First practice match: Nepal to face Scotland today

The Nepali national cricket team is geared up for their first practice match against Scotland as part of their preparation for the upcoming World Cup qualifiers. The much-anticipated match is scheduled to kick off today at 12:45 PM Nepali time in South Africa.

Having recently arrived in South Africa for an intensive training camp, Nepal aims to fine-tune their skills and strategies before heading to Zimbabwe for the World Cup qualifiers, set to take place from 18 June to 19 July. This practice match against Scotland serves as a crucial opportunity for the Nepali players to assess their form and gain valuable match practice.

The encounter carries additional significance as Nepal previously secured a victory against Scotland on their home turf. The Nepali team’s triumph over Scotland has boosted their confidence and instilled a sense of determination within the players. Now, facing their opponents once again, albeit in a different setting, Nepal seeks to demonstrate their continued growth and maintain their winning momentum.
